‫۱۰ سال و ۳ ماه قبل، جمعه ۲۰ تیر ۱۳۹۳، ساعت ۲۰:۱۰
تا حالا شده که شما بخوای یه فیلد از جدولو در یه مقطعی پر کنی بعد فیلد‌های بعدی رو در جاهای دیگه پر کنید ؟ خوب وقتی مقدار فیلد‌ها نال پذیر نباشه نمیشه در مرحله ای اول اون فیلدو ذخیره کرد ! حالا چون ولیدیشن‌های MVC  رو هم نیاز دارم پس باید requird هم باشه فیلد ها... تا در مراحل بعدی بگم کدام فیلد‌ها ورودشون اجباریه ! منطقش درسته ! این کاری که می‌گم  برای ذخیره سازی چند جدول به صورت همزمانه ! که چند جدول با هم ارتباط هم دارن ! توی database first کار میکنه  اما توی code first به دلیل این مشکل کار نمی‌کرد ! من فقط می‌خوام وقتی داده‌ی در جدول اولی ذخیره شد ایدی اون در جدول دومی ذخیره بشه به عنوان کلید خارجی بعد اطلاعات دیگه بعدا پر بشه ! همین ! مرسی از لینک‌های که قرارا دادین برسی کردم  لینک دوم کاری که من انجام دادمو اورده سمت کلاینت . و تقریبا مشکلم حل شد . تشکر
‫۱۰ سال و ۳ ماه قبل، جمعه ۲۰ تیر ۱۳۹۳، ساعت ۱۷:۱۹
این کاری که شما گفتین دوباره کاریه! و فیلد‌های که من دارم و همچنین جداول خیلی زیادن. من تونستم NULL  بودن و اعتبار سنجی سمت سرور رو انجام بدم؛ با کد‌هایی که زیر قرار میدم . اما چطوری با جی کوری ایجکس باید این ولیدیشنو سمن کلاینت نیز فرا خوامی بکنم ؟

 [AttributeUsage(AttributeTargets.Field | AttributeTargets.Property, AllowMultiple = false, Inherited = true)]
    public class RequierdٍExAttribute : ValidationAttribute
    {
        public RequierdٍExAttribute(string ErrorMessage)
            : base()
        {
            this.ErrorMessage = ErrorMessage;
        }
       
        public override bool IsValid(object value)
        {
            if (value == null) return false;
         
            return true;
      }
حالا بجای Requierdٍ روی فیلد‌ها از  RequierdٍEx  استفاده میکنم که فیلد مورد نظر در دیتا بیس نال پذیر ساخته میشه . اما مشکل اعتبار سنجی سمت کلاینته؟ 
‫۱۰ سال و ۳ ماه قبل، پنجشنبه ۱۹ تیر ۱۳۹۳، ساعت ۲۰:۴۸
سلام . یه سوال داشتم . توی  codefirst می‌خوام فیلد‌های جدول تولید شده نالیبل باشند و از اعتبار سنجی سمت کلاینت و سرور( MVC ) هم استفاده کنم [Requierd] . اگه امکانش هست راهنمای کنید ؟